General Equipment Specification Supply Voltage Input: 48 Vdc Frequency Bands: TX Block A : 1930 – 1945 MHz Block D : 1945 – 1950 MHz Block B : 1950 – 1965 MHz Block E : 1965 – 1970 MHz Block F : 1970 – 1975 MHz Block C : 1975 – 1990 MHz Frequency Bands: RX Block A : 1850 – 1865 MHz Block B : 1865 – 1870 MHz Block C : 1870 – 1885 MHz Block D : 1885 – 1890 MHz Block E : 1890 – 1895 MHz Block F : 1895 – 1910 MHz W-CDMA GSM NADC (4M23F9W) (200KG7W) (40K0DXW) Type of Modulation and Designator: Maximum No. of Carriers: 1 Output Impedance: 50 ohms Per channel:416.9 mW RF Output: Software Duplexer Fullband Band Selection: Nemko Dallas, Inc. FCC PART 24, SUBPART E FCC ID: L7KWTRC-01 BROADBAND PCS BASE STATION TRANSMITTER EQUIPMENT: Supreme Indoor Test Report No.: 4L0356RUS1 Page 6 of 30 System Description The BTS performs the radio function of the Base Station System (BSS), and is connected to the Radio Network Controller (RNC) via the Abis interface, and to Mobile Stations (MS) via the Air interface (Antenna). The BSC is further connected to the Mobile Switching Center (MSC) and the Operation and Maintenance Center (OMC). Setup for testing: The transmitter was set up according to 3GPP TS 25.141 Test Model 1 for all tests except frequency stability. 64 DPCHs at 30 ksps (SF=128) distributed randomly across the code space, at random power levels and random timing offsets, were defined to simulate a realistic operating scenario which may have high PAR (Peak-to-Average Ratio). The transmitter was set up according to 3GPP TS 25.141 Test Model 4 for the frequency stability tests. System Diagram Nemko Dallas, Inc.
